Extraction of Antioxidant Degradation Products from High-density Polyethylene Bottles and Migration Studies in Soybean Oil(for Injection)
Objective:To investigate the compatibility of antioxidant degradation products in HDPE bottles with soybean oil for injection and to assess the safety risk of the three antioxidant degradation products in HDPE bottles.Methods:A gas chromatography-mass spectrometry(GC-MS)method was developed and validated for the determination of the degradation products in HDPE bottles and the migration of the degradation products into soybean oil.Results:The method was well applicable,accurate,stable and methodologically compliant.The method was applied to three batches of soybean oil for injection and DBP,DBB and DBHBA were not detected under the accelerated test(40℃±2℃,75%±5%,left for 0,3 and 6 months)and long-term test(25℃±2℃,60%±10%,left for 3,6,9 and 12 months)test conditions.Conclusion:The antioxidant degradation products in HDPE bottles failed to migrate into soybean oil for injection,the package is compatible with soybean oil for injection and provides a viable basis for its safety risk assessment.
